Herzing University - Atlanta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Herzing University - Atlanta was $585 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In State Out of State
Tuition $13,320 $13,320
Fees $880 $880

One factor in determining the overall cost in a degree is to consider how much in student loans you’ll have to take out. Legal Support students who received their bachelor’s degree at Herzing University - Atlanta took out an average of $49,817 in student loans. That is 40% higher than the national average of $35,709.

The median early career salary of legal support students who receive their bachelor’s degree from Herzing University - Atlanta is $33,993 per year. That is 5% higher than the national average of $32,337.

In the 2019-2020 academic year, 3 students received their bachelor’s degree in legal support.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Of the students who received their bachelor’s degree in legal support in 2019-2020, 66.7% of them were women. This is less than the nationwide number of 78.7%.

*The racial-ethnic minorities count is calculated by taking the total number of students and subtracting white students, international students, and students whose race/ethnicity was unknown. This number is then divided by the total number of students at the school to obtain the racial-ethnic minorities percentage.
